Students will learn about the impact human actions and technologies have on ecosystems in the environment, and the organizations that are working to make a difference.
Success Criteria:
-
identify human actions that alter balances and interactions in the environment
-
identify the technologies that alter balances and interactions in the environment
-
determine if human activities or technology is having a positive or negative impact
-
create two dioramas that respectively depict the ‘before’ and ‘after’ of human and/or technological interference
-
recognize the costs and benefits of human and technological involvement
-
research, record, and share information about an ecosystem that is being affected by human activity or technology
-
research, record and share information about an organization that works toward ecological sustainability
-
create a pamphlet to inform the public about the efforts of the organization
Suggestions for differentiation are also included so that all students can be successful in the learning environment.
